Mexico: Hurricane - OCHA-06: 30-Sep-01
OCHA Situation Report No. 6
Mexico - Tropical Depression Juliette
30 September 2001
This message is not an official warning or alert for any country
1. Juliette has been downgraded to a tropical depression and all tropical
storm warnings have been discontinued for the Baja California peninsula.
2. The National Weather Center in Miami reports that at 1500 GMT, 30
September 2001, the center of tropical depression Juliette was located
near latitude 25.6 north, longitude 112.0 west, or about 120 miles (195
km) south of Santa Rosalia on the east coast of the central Baja
California peninsula. Maximum sustained winds are near 35 mph (55 km/hr)
with higher gusts.
3. The tropical depression is moving toward the north at near 6 mph (9
km/hr) and this general motion is expected to continue for the next 24
hours. Additional rainfall is expected today and tonight primarily over
northwestern mainland Mexico. There continues to be a threat of flash
floods and mud slides near mountainous terrain.
